    I don't believe that waiting until the next day or saving it many times would have anything to do with whether it becomes bold again.  I can only offer a possible workaround, not a permanent answer to the problem, as I don't have any idea what is wrong. 

    As a temporary fix you could try this:  Select the equation text and paste it back as a Paste Special - Unformatted text.  Then apply whatever font if you want.  Perhaps trying the Cambria Math font outside the equation box would be a good test to see if the problem keeps happening.  If it does, you might need to reinstall the font.
